    Ahhhhh... the memories.

    This is the first Boxer I looked at in my quest.

    Hard toolkit case is for an early car. '83 should have a soft role inside a soft zippered pouch that is color keyed to the interior.

    Owners pouch is from a late model car, only thing that is correct is the brown owners manual on the right.
